As part of the 2026 Florence Summer Institute, Dr. Jennifer Taber will be teaching the psychology course "Emotions, Culture, & Health." 

Course Description

Emotions drive everyday behaviors and are critical in understanding health and well-being. In this class, we will participate in a century-old yet still pressing debate about the underlying nature of emotion: biological vs. cultural. Our primary goal: to attempt to resolve this debate based on evidence accumulated throughout the course. Through museum visits, class discussions, lecture, and videos, we consider different scientific perspectives on how emotions are created and expressed. We will discuss evolutionary and socio-cultural models of emotion and consider how both positive and negative emotions are adaptive and functional and how they differ across cultures. We will also explore theories of stress and learn about concrete coping strategies— with direct implications for daily life— and observe and analyze emotions as they are expressed in art.
